Why competitor-following SEO tools become misalignment engines under SVS

What competitor tools actually do

SEO tools that follow competitors reverse-engineer:

  • keyword overlap
  • topic expansion
  • content gaps
  • backlink profiles
  • publishing cadence

They assume external alignment is the goal.

That assumption is the flaw.
